Joe Jonas mental health struggles became a major talking point this week after the singer revealed that the disappointing sales of his first solo album triggered significant personal distress. Jonas admitted that the commercial underperformance of his solo project led him to experience recurring panic attacks, a challenge that ultimately pushed him to seek professional therapy.
Understanding the impact of joe jonas mental health struggles
In a candid discussion on his podcast, Jonas explained that the pressure of the music industry often masks the reality of how artists handle public reception. When the numbers didn't meet industry expectations, the internal toll was immediate. He described the period as a wake-up call that forced him to confront his well-being rather than focusing solely on professional output.
For many fans in Pakistan who follow global pop culture, this admission serves as a reminder that even high-profile celebrities are not immune to the pressures of performance and public failure. The singer emphasized that reaching out for help was the most critical step in managing his anxiety, highlighting the importance of de-stigmatizing therapy.
Why seeking support matters
- Acknowledging the problem: Jonas noted that ignoring the symptoms only made the panic attacks more frequent.
- Professional intervention: Therapy provided him with the necessary tools to process career disappointments without internalizing them as personal failures.
- Long-term recovery: By speaking out, he aims to encourage others in high-pressure fields to prioritize their mental health over commercial success.
